About Me

I am 32 years old, male. I have been brought up in a single family setup in rural areas of Kenya where life was hard to afford some basic needs. Professionally I am an IT person and proprietor.
I have a shop where we sell lady bags and ladies wear. I began this job after taking some part of my salary to fund the business. So far i manage to make small profit margins and i believe an injection of extra capital will help to increase the margins.

My Business

I sell lady bags and ladies wear in Nakuru kenya. The revenues so far has so far been used for my education and some i do add back to my business.
My major motivation for this request is to allow me create employment to orphaned youths within my home area .
Am kindly requesting lenders to support me in making this purchase because it will go a long way in achieving my passion of creating employment to the so youths who are job seeking and also act as a source of inspiration to them too

Loan Proposal

They say what serves you better nurture it and so we want to nurture our ladies bags and ladies wear. We have a deficit of roughly 150 dollars so as to import some consignment of bags from Dubai and a few clothes from Uganda. Dear lender help us manage to bring these stuff. We have a ready market.
